dc.description.abstract The stringent norms laid down by Pollution Control Boards are forcing Industries to have efficient waste water treatment plants. However, there are no protocols to reduce waste water production to encourage water reclamation and sustainability. The objective of this thesis work is to achieve the same for a dairy industry. In this work, a unique scheme is suggested which leads to reduction in water usage. The result shows that more than 5% of water used per day can be reclaimed. Further, the ETP is modeled and simulated at steady state with feasible modifications that leads to 10% increase in energy that can be harnessed from improved Biogas production rate and 85% reduction in energy usage at the ETP. The possibilities of nitrous oxide emissions, a green house gas, are simulated. The results fall in line with the theory available in literature for the same. en_US
